The boy said, “I don’t want to go to school.” Change into Indirect Speech

  1. Indirect Speech: The boy said that he didn’t want to go to school.

    Explanation: When the reporting verb is in the past (said) and the direct speech is in the present indefinite tense (simple present tense), then the indirect (reported) speech will change into the past indefinite tense.

    Present Indefinite Tense > Past Indefinite Tense.
